Transaction 7dd3ee50a35664e08c6123887169e8e975329e65ce9696a00359444ccce7dd6d
1 Input
1 Output
-
7dd3ee50a35664e08c6123887169e8e975329e65ce9696a00359444ccce7dd6d:0
- value
- 23632500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8eeeb5034314c1d893db1e7a26a50a926d97180b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E2kuu89LcHggt2ENYfYTh7nyTrNj8tL6T